Thirty thousand people in 90-degree heat, packed onto the National Mall, singing worship songs and praying for America’s future. That’s not a metaphor or a nostalgia reel, it’s what David and Tim Barton witnessed firsthand in Washington, DC, during a major rededication gathering timed to the 250th anniversary of the Second Continental Congress call for a national day of humiliation, fasting, and prayer. We share what it felt like on the ground, from the atmosphere of worship to the very real moments of fatigue, sunburn, and even people passing out in the crowd. We also dig into the deeper meaning behind the headlines. Why does this moment matter historically and spiritually? We connect early American prayer proclamations to today’s hunger for moral clarity, and we talk honestly about what lands well and what can feel more like a program than a prayer meeting. Along the way, we highlight some of the most impactful voices and songs, including the closing worship set that culminates in Chris Tomlin leading “Holy Forever” with the Washington Monument behind him and the Capitol in view. Then we bring it home with the question that actually changes things: what do we take back to our communities? We walk through a powerful biblical framework from Nehemiah, emphasize repentance and personal responsibility, and argue that lasting political renewal can’t outrun spiritual renewal.
